Whole Raw Hemp Seeds

Whole raw hemp seeds are nutrient-dense seeds packed with protein, healthy fats, and essential minerals. They are known for their potential health benefits, including supporting heart health and providing a complete source of protein.

Rich in om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ids, which are essential for heart health and reducing inflammation.
Contains all nine essential amino acids, making them a complete protein source ideal for vegetarians and vegans.

Almonds

Almonds are nutrient-dense seeds known for their high content of healthy fats, protein, and essential vitamins and minerals. They are widely recognized for their health benefits, including heart health and weight management.

Rich in monounsaturated fats, almonds can help lower bad cholesterol levels and reduce the risk of heart disease.
High in antioxidants, particularly vitamin E, almonds protect cells from oxidative stress and inflammation.

2. Micronutrient Profile (Vitamins and Minerals)

Micronutrient analysis highlights the essential vitamins and minerals of each food, expressed as a percentage of the recommended Daily Value (%DV).

Whole Raw Hemp Seeds's profile is highly notable for: phosphorus (1650mg, 236% VDR) and magnesium (700mg, 175% VDR) and manganese (3.3mg, 165% VDR).

Conversely, Almonds stands out especially in: Vitamin E (25.6mg, 170% VDR) and vitamin b2 (riboflavin) (1.1mg, 85% VDR) and magnesium (268mg, 67% VDR).
